The Yamhill-Carlton American Viticultural Area was established in 2004. The federal petition to create the area was authored by Ken Wright and was one of six sub-AVA's created simultaneously in the northern Willamette Valley. This AVA is dominated by ancient sedimentary parent material (mother rock). The weathered sandstone and siltstone substrata were originally created by the subduction of the Juan de Fuca plate as it plunged underneath the North American continent. Pinot noir produced from this region displays savory, spicy and floral qualities and a lush textural palate. Artwork by David Berkvan. Oregon promise. kenwrightcellars.com.
